[PATCH v2 3/9] media: imx: Use dedicated format handler for i.MX7/8

From: Alexander Stein
Date: Fri Feb 11 2022 - 09:28:18 EST


From: Dorota Czaplejewicz <dorota.czaplejewicz@xxxxxxx>

This splits out a format handler which takes into account
the capabilities of the i.MX7/8 video device,
as opposed to the default handler compatible with both i.MX5/6 and i.MX7/8.

+static int imx78_media_mbus_fmt_to_pix_fmt(struct v4l2_pix_format *pix,
+ const struct v4l2_mbus_framefmt *mbus,
+ const struct imx_media_pixfmt *cc)
+{
+ u32 aligned_width;
+ int ret;
+
+ if (!cc)
+ cc = imx_media_find_mbus_format(mbus->code, PIXFMT_SEL_ANY);
+
+ if (!cc)
+ return -EINVAL;
+ /*
+ * The hardware can handle line lengths divisible by 4 pixels
+ * as long as the whole buffer size ends up divisible by 8 bytes.
+ * If not, use the value of 8 pixels recommended in the datasheet.
+ * Only 8bits-per-pixel formats may need to get aligned to 8 pixels,
+ * because both 10-bit and 16-bit pixels occupy 2 bytes.
+ * In those, 4-pixel aligmnent is equal to 8-byte alignment.
+ */
+ if (cc->bpp == 1)
+ aligned_width = round_up(mbus->width, 8);
+ else
+ aligned_width = round_up(mbus->width, 4);
+
+ ret = v4l2_fill_pixfmt(pix, cc->fourcc,
+ aligned_width, mbus->height);
+ if (ret)
+ return ret;
+
+ pix->colorspace = mbus->colorspace;
+ pix->xfer_func = mbus->xfer_func;
+ pix->ycbcr_enc = mbus->ycbcr_enc;
+ pix->quantization = mbus->quantization;
+ pix->field = mbus->field;
+
+ return ret;
+}
